What is Nonviolent Communication?

Nonviolent Communication is the integration of 4 things: - Consciousness: a set of concepts that support living a life of empathy, collaboration, credibility, and guts

Language: comprehending how words contribute to connection or range

Communication: understanding how to request for what we want, how to hear others even in difference, and how to move toward services that work for all

Means of impact: sharing "power with others" rather than using "power over others" Nonviolent Communication serves our desire to do 3 things:

Increase our ability to deal with significance, connection, and choice

Link empathically with self and others to have more rewarding relationships

Sharing of resources so everyone is able to benefit
